What makes 225 unusual

Two hundred and twenty-five is 15 squared, and it hides one of arithmetic's prettiest identities: the sum of the first five cubes — 1 plus 8 plus 27 plus 64 plus 125 — equals 225, which is the square of the sum of the first five numbers. That is no coincidence: Nicomachus proved eighteen centuries ago that the cubes always sum to the square of the triangle, for every run of numbers there is. Accumulation squared, as a theorem.

The number itself has properties worth knowing, because numerology borrows its vocabulary from them. 225 is:

  • A perfect square: 15² = 225
  • Divisible by 3, 5, 9, 15, 25, 45 and 1 more, so it breaks into 7 different even arrangements
  • A multiple of nine, so its digits always sum back to nine no matter how far you take it

An honest note
  • There is no evidence that numbers carry messages. Seeing 225 repeatedly is usually frequency illusion — once a number matters to you, your attention starts finding it everywhere it already was.
  • That does not make it useless. A number you keep noticing is a free, self-made cue to return to what you actually want, several times a day, without an app reminder.
